The College of Europe is accepting online applications for Master’s programmes for the academic year 2024-2025. Scholarships are available for students from Eastern Partnership countries, including Ukraine. The College of Europe offers several different master’s programmes in Bruges (Belgium), Natolin (Poland), or the recently created campus in Tirana (Albania). These programs include European Economic Studies, European Law, European Political and Governance Studies, as well as International Relations and EU Diplomacy.
Deadline – 16 January 2024
